Introduction (Nintendo WFC)

Twice a month, it was possible to connect to the Mario Kart Channel and receive a tournament to play. It was quite similar to Mario Kart DS's Mission Mode. The player went in one of the 43 available tracks and arenas and performed special tasks in altered versions of the tracks. Some of these tournaments have been cracked open and have been turned into custom tracks.

Unfortunately, not all tournaments are possible to be turned into custom tracks because some have requirements that would not work in a race properly, for example collecting all coins or passing through gates. This also includes tournaments that are the same as normal tracks (such as a kart-only race without item boxes, for example). Tournaments with backward tracks, races on battle arenas and harder versions of tracks are all possible to play on VS mode.

It is possible to rip tournaments from a save game file called wc24dl.vff, or MEM2 can be dumped with USB Gecko.

Tournament Mode

Vulcanus2 found a way to play ripped tournaments via the original way using the Mario Kart Channel on 2011-03-25. This requires Riivolution v1.04 or later (for savegame patch) and savegame edit (with a hex editor).

Tutorial on how to play old tournaments
  1. Rip a savegame using Riivolution v1.04 or later. You will get four files, but the important one is wc24dl.vff.
  2. Open the file in a hex editor and search for RKCT. Also open a RKC file with a hex editor, paste the whole content of the RKC file at the savegame (RKCT).
  3. Scroll down to check if after the data are many zeros.
    • If so, save the file and play it using a savegame.
    • If not (when the file is smaller than the original), clear all data after it until you see the zeros.
      • Note: the savegame must be ripped during a tournament (not after the deadline), otherwise the player will not be able to load it since the tournament has already finished.

Competitions (Tournaments) on Wiimmfi

On 2016-05-10, competitions (tournaments) were revived for Wiimmfi. Leseratte developed the code and also collected all of Nintendo's files. Only one of the original competitions is currently missing. Further information can be found here.
